Austin Cantrell Signs With Arkansas

Tight End. Roland, Oklahoma.

If there was a diamond in the rough find that Arkansas got in this class it is probably Austin Cantrell. Before last March Cantrell was an unknown prospect from Roland, Oklahoma. Then he unofficially visited Fayetteville in March and the Razorbacks offered on the spot.

Cantrell was a low 3-star prospect shortly after he committed to Arkansas. Once football season rolled around he shot up the recruiting rankings and the Oklahoma Sooners came calling and offered him. Cantrell had already closed his recruitment and stayed firm on his commitment to Arkansas. He officially visited Arkansas back in October and Barry Lunney Jr. was his recruiter at Arkansas. Player Ratings:

247Sports- 4* with a grade of 92

Rivals- 3*

Scout- 3*

ESPN- 3* with a grade of 79

Cantrell is one of three extremely talented tight ends Arkansas is bringing in with this class. He joins C.J. O'Grady and Will Gragg at that position. With Hunter Henry returning next season Arkansas will be loaded with talent at that position.
